    Zovegalisib purchased from MedChemExpress. Usage Cited in: Br J Cancer. 2025 Aug;133(2):144-154.  [Abstract]

    Compared to mutant-specific PI3Kα inhibitors (RLY-2608 (Zovegalisib) & STX-478) and PI3Kα inhibitor/degrader inavolisib, the sapanisertib plus serabelisib combination had a substantially lower mean IC50 i.e., 32.0 nM versus 0.89 μM (inavolisib), 6.13 μM (STX-478), 4.85 μM (RLY-2608, Zovegalisib).

    Descripciòn

    Zovegalisib (RLY-2608) is an orally active first-in-class allosteric mutant-selective inhibitor of PI3Ka with anti-tumor activity. Zovegalisib inhibits tumor growth in PIK3CA-mutant xenograft mice models with minimal impact on insulin[1][2][3].

    In Vitro

    Zovegalisib (RLY-2608) (1 nM-100 μM, 5 days) inhibits the proliferation and phosphorylated AKT (pAKT) in PIK3CA mutant cancer cell lines independent of the hotspot mutation[2].

    In Vivo

    Zovegalisib (RLY-2608) (25-100 mg/kg, p.o., twice a day for 50 days) inhibits tumors in tumor xenograft mice models with reduced impact on insulin levels[1].
    Zovegalisib (12.5-100 mg/kg, p.o., a single dose for 4 days) demonstrates potent tumor growth inhibition in Balb/c nude female mice bearing HSC-2 tumors[2].
